- The distance between Klepinino, Ukraine and Ze Doca, Brazil is approximately 9,510 km or 5,910 mi.
- To reach Klepinino in this distance one would set out from Ze Doca bearing 43.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Klepinino bearing 80° or E .
- Klepinino has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Ze Doca has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Klepinino is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Ze Doca is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 16 °C (28.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22 °C (39.6°F) more in Klepinino.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1412.4 mm (55.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1412.4 l/m² (34.66 US gal/ft²) or 14,124,000 l/ha (1,509,949 US gal/ac) less. About 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.9° lower in Klepinino than in Ze Doca.
